<br />APPROVE CONSTRUCTION CONTRACT - PUMP NO. 3 DRIVE REPLACEMENT
<br />(WASTEWATER TREATMENT PLANT)
<br />In accordance with the bid awarded on December 7, 1992, to Shaum
<br />Electric Company, 1125 North Nappanee Street, Elkhart, Indiana,
<br />in the amount of $246,260.00 for the above referred to project, a
<br />Contract in said amount was submitted for Board approval. Upon a
<br />motion made by Mrs. Mueller, seconded by Mr. Caldwell and
<br />carried, the Contract was approved and the appropriate
<br />Certificate of Insurance, Performance Bond and Labor and
<br />Materials Payment Bond as submitted were filed.
<br />APPROVE ADDENDUM TO LIMITED ADMINISTRATORS AGREEMENT (LINCOLN
<br />NATIONAL)
<br />It was noted that this is an amendment to our current contract
<br />with Lincoln National for flex account administration. Employers
<br />Health Insurance (EHIC) is the successor to Lincoln National on
<br />this contract. This extends the administration period for ninety
<br />(90) days for a fee of $8,157.60. Upon a motion made by Ms.
<br />Mueller, seconded by Mr. Leszczynski and carried, the addendum
<br />was approved.
<br />AWARD BID - FORD STREET SEWER LINERS 1992
<br />In a Memorandum to the Board, Mr. Carl P. Littrell, Director,
<br />Division of Engineering, advised that on December 14, 1992, the
<br />Board received and opened one (1) bid for the above referenced
<br />project. Mr. Littrell stated that he has reviewed this one (1)
<br />bid and found that the amount of the bid agrees with the amount
<br />read at the Board meeting. Therefore, Mr. Littrell recommended
<br />that the Board award the bid of Insituform Midwest, Inc., 111th &
<br />Archer, P.O. Box 458, Lemont, Illinois, in the amount of
<br />$79,292.50. Mr. Littrell noted that the unit prices offered on
<br />this Contract are in line with prices offered for the same kind
<br />of work one (1) year ago. Insituform Midwest performed that work
<br />successfully and efficiently. Therefore, Mr. Caldwell made a
<br />motion that the recommendation be accepted and the bid be
<br />awarded. Mrs. Mueller seconded the motion which carried.
<br />AWARD QUOTATION - WATERPROOFING OF COVELESKI REGIONAL STADIUM
<br />Mr. Bob Allen, Manager, Bureau of Public Construction, advised
<br />that on December 14, 1992, the Board received Quotations for the
<br />waterproofing of the split face block at the Coveleski Regional
<br />Stadium. Mr. Allen noted that he has reviewed the Quotations and
<br />found that the amounts agree with the amounts read at the
<br />meeting.
<br />Mr. Allen noted that Advanced Masonry Construction Company, Inc.,
<br />53266 Bonvale Drive, South Bend, Indiana, submitted the low
<br />Quotation in the amount of $13,867.00. However, they have asked
<br />to withdraw their Quotation as it contained a quantity
<br />calculation error.
<br />Therefore, Mr. Allen recommended that the Board award the next
<br />low Quotation submitted by Casteel Construction Corporation,
<br />23186 West Ireland Road, South Bend, Indiana, in the amount of
<br />$23,892.00.
<br />Mrs. Mueller made a motion that the recommendation be accepted
<br />and the Quotation be awarded. Mr. Caldwell seconded the motion
<br />which carried.
